summaryrefslogtreecommitdiffstats
path: root/src/freedreno
Commit message (Expand)AuthorAgeFilesLines
* turnip: Disable UBWC on images used as storage images.Eric Anholt2020-01-211-0/+12
* turnip: Add limited support for storage images.Eric Anholt2020-01-216-19/+116
* turnip: Refactor the intrinsic lowering.Eric Anholt2020-01-211-35/+48
* turnip: Fix some whitespace around binary operators.Eric Anholt2020-01-211-3/+3
* freedreno: Stop scattered remapping of SSBOs/images to IBOs.Eric Anholt2020-01-218-51/+63
* turnip: Refactor linkage state setup.Eric Anholt2020-01-211-20/+20
* turnip: fix invalid VK_ERROR_OUT_OF_POOL_MEMORYHyunjun Ko2020-01-211-0/+3
* vulkan/wsi: Use the interface from the real modifiers extensionJason Ekstrand2020-01-172-12/+14
* turnip: Pretend to support Vulkan 1.2Jason Ekstrand2020-01-153-13/+13
* freedreno/ir3: rename instructionsRob Clark2020-01-157-14/+25
* nir/lower_atomics_to_ssbo: Also lower barriersJason Ekstrand2020-01-131-2/+0
* nir: Rename nir_intrinsic_barrier to control_barrierJason Ekstrand2020-01-132-3/+3
* nir: Add a new memory_barrier_tcs_patch intrinsicJason Ekstrand2020-01-131-0/+1
* freedreno/drm: Fix memory leak in softpin implementationLasse Lopperi2020-01-101-0/+2
* ir3: Set up full/half register conflicts correctlyKristian H. Kristensen2020-01-091-2/+1
* turnip: Use VK_NULL_HANDLE instead of NULL.Bas Nieuwenhuizen2020-01-021-1/+1
* freedreno/ir3: fix flat shading againRob Clark2019-12-241-1/+1
* turnip: disable B8G8R8 vertex formatsJonathan Marek2019-12-191-6/+6
* turnip: minor warning fixesJonathan Marek2019-12-192-2/+2
* turnip: implement secondary command buffersJonathan Marek2019-12-193-2/+62
* turnip: compute gmem offsets at renderpass creation timeJonathan Marek2019-12-194-66/+82
* turnip: emit_compute_driver_params fixesJonathan Marek2019-12-191-17/+14
* turnip: emit base instance vs driver paramJonathan Marek2019-12-191-0/+53
* freedreno/ir3: support load_base_instanceJonathan Marek2019-12-194-1/+12
* freedreno/registers: document vertex/instance id offset bitsJonathan Marek2019-12-192-2/+7
* freedreno/a6xx: RB6_R8G8B8 is actually 32 bit RGBXKristian H. Kristensen2019-12-192-2/+2
* freedreno/ir3: fix vertex shader sysvals with pre_assign_inputsJonathan Marek2019-12-191-1/+1
* turnip: don't set SP_FS_CTRL_REG0_VARYING if only fragcoord is usedJonathan Marek2019-12-181-1/+1
* turnip: add cache invalidate to fix input attachment casesJonathan Marek2019-12-181-1/+15
* freedreno: Fix CP_MEM_TO_REG flag definitionsConnor Abbott2019-12-181-2/+4
* freedreno: Use new macros for CP_WAIT_REG_MEM and CP_WAIT_MEM_GTEConnor Abbott2019-12-181-6/+7
* a6xx: Add more CP packetsConnor Abbott2019-12-182-19/+282
* freedreno/ir3: update prefetch input_offset when packing inlocsJonathan Marek2019-12-171-0/+4
* freedreno/a6xx: Document the CP_SET_DRAW_STATE enable bitsKristian H. Kristensen2019-12-172-22/+21
* turnip: Fix support for immutable samplers.Eric Anholt2019-12-162-12/+15
* turnip: don't set LRZ enable at end of renderpassJonathan Marek2019-12-171-1/+1
* freedreno/ir3: lower pack/unpack opsJonathan Marek2019-12-161-0/+24
* turnip: Add support for descriptor arrays.Eric Anholt2019-12-165-112/+217
* turnip: Drop unused variable.Eric Anholt2019-12-161-1/+0
* turnip: remove duplicate A6XX_SP_CS_CONFIG_NIBOJonathan Marek2019-12-161-2/+1
* turnip: change emit_ibo to be like emit_texturesJonathan Marek2019-12-161-32/+48
* turnip: fix emit_iboJonathan Marek2019-12-161-8/+25
* turnip: remove compute emit_border_colorJonathan Marek2019-12-161-1/+1
* turnip: fix emit_textures for compute shadersJonathan Marek2019-12-161-6/+9
* freedreno/ir3: lower mul_2x32_64Jonathan Marek2019-12-161-0/+3
* turnip: implement CmdFillBuffer/CmdUpdateBufferJonathan Marek2019-12-161-0/+56
* turnip: don't require src image to be set for clear blitsJonathan Marek2019-12-162-2/+2
* turnip: use common blit path for buffer copyJonathan Marek2019-12-163-166/+53
* turnip: use single substream csJonathan Marek2019-12-162-25/+16
* turnip: Lower usub_borrow.Eric Anholt2019-12-161-0/+2